    I am attempting to make a server, and as I was following Dell Honne's guide, something stopped me in my tracks.

    Adding linked servers

    Where do I do this in MSSQL?
    I cannot find a feature saying "Link Server"

    Is it a query?

    I am also having a hard time understanding what 'SQL SERVER INSTANZNAME' means...

    Press New Query then write the query:

    Code:
    exec sys.sp_addlinkedserver  'RANKING', '', 'SQLNCLI', 'XXX\SQLEXPRESS', null, null, 'RANKING_DBF'
    
    exec sys.sp_serveroption @server='RANKING', @optname='rpc', @optvalue='true'
    exec sys.sp_serveroption @server='RANKING', @optname='rpc out', @optvalue='true'
    in XXX\SQLEXPRESS write ur sqlexpress name like mine is HOME-A84C9D631E\SQLEXPRESS
    then excute
    and do the same to the other 2 querys
